Considering the Real-Life Stitch Out

Let’s walk through a real scenario. Suppose a client orders a custom embroidered sweatshirt as a Christmas gift for their sister, an SICU nurse. I’d choose a premium, medium-textured sweatshirt fabric. The design’s detail level and likely use of text mean stitch density and small details are crucial. I’d absolutely test it on scrap fabric first, especially to check the clarity of any lettering and the behavior of fill stitch or satin stitch areas. A proper stabilizer is non-negotiable here to prevent puckering, especially on a garment like a sweatshirt.

Where Caution is Needed

This isn’t a design I’d automatically run on a delicate baby garment or a very thin, stretchy tee without careful adjustment. Tiny lettering or intricate corners could lose definition on highly textured fabrics or dark fabric if thread color contrast isn’t planned well. For curved surfaces like caps, the layout needs to be evaluated for distortion. Similarly, on very small hoop sizes, some details might need to be simplified to maintain clarity. Products destined for frequent washing, like kitchen towels, require a robust stitch execution to ensure longevity.
